Adrian Freihofer 2f6a47c4d4 runqemu: support multiple NICs
Emulating more than one network interface with runqemu is a bit tricky,
but possible. For example, the following leads to an emulated device with
eth0 and eth1:

QB_NETWORK_DEVICE_prepend = " \
    -device virtio-net-device,mac=52:54:00:12:34:03 \
"

or

QB_NETWORK_DEVICE_append = " \
    -device virtio-net-pci,mac=52:54:00:12:34:03 \
"

When booting Qemu with two NICs, the kernel does not know which
interface the specified ip=192.168.7.... command line argument
should be applied. This delays the boot process for a very long
time and a guest wihtout IP configuration.

This add two new configuraton parameters to runqemu:
QB_CMDLINE_IP_SLIRP and QB_CMDLINE_IP_TAP to explicitely specify the ip=
kernel command line arguments for tap and slirp mode.

Note: Simply adding "::eth0" broke some builds on the Yocto autobuilder.

QEMU Emulation Targets
======================

To simplify development, the build system supports building images to
work with the QEMU emulator in system emulation mode. Several architectures
are currently supported in 32 and 64 bit variants:

  * ARM (qemuarm + qemuarm64)
  * x86 (qemux86 + qemux86-64)
  * PowerPC (qemuppc only)
  * MIPS (qemumips + qemumips64)

Use of the QEMU images is covered in the Yocto Project Reference Manual.
The appropriate MACHINE variable value corresponding to the target is given
in brackets.
